Let me try to explain this to the best of my ability...

Is there a way to create a matte/mask/layer over a specific point/object on my video and make it completely transparent so it will basically be invisible and you can see the background behind it? If I wanted to make my hand invisible, for example, is there a way using a matte or would i have to put a duplicate video behind the original and crop it out?

Yes, you would need to use 2 pieces of video to do this - there is no technology to cut out one layer of a 2D image to reveal a second layer of a 2D image if there are not specifically 2 2D images to use (ie: 2 layers of video). There are some "tricks" that can be done, but it takes a lot of work. It's easier to use two shots. If you're using FCP7, then you have FCS3 - you can use Motion to create a cutout with motion tracking and use a second clip of the background behind you (you didn't mention the version of software you were using, so I was assuming you were using FCE instead of FCP from your previous post).
